Mistral AI announced a 650 million dollar Series C on July 24 2026 that values the company at 8.2 billion dollars. The round was led by Eurazeo and Bpifrance with participation from Lightspeed and Salesforce Ventures. Proceeds will fund a new Paris supercluster and expanded enterprise sales teams.
The company reported 180 million dollars in annualized recurring revenue as of June 2026 with 65 percent coming from European customers. Mistral's latest large model reached 87.3 percent on MMLU and is available through a dedicated sovereign cloud region in France.
Previous rounds include a 600 million dollar Series B in late 2025. The startup has positioned itself as the compliant European alternative to US foundation model providers amid ongoing data sovereignty discussions.
Why this matters
The valuation confirms sustained investor appetite for non-US model developers despite US dominance in frontier labs. European regulators are expected to cite Mistral's growth when finalizing the AI Act implementation guidelines in 2027.
Enterprise buyers now have a credible option for keeping training data within EU borders while accessing competitive performance. Mistral plans additional language-specific fine-tunes for German and Spanish markets by year end.
